RICHARD
HENMI
Richard Henmi was born on January 3, 1924, in Fresno, California. Henmi
was seventeen years old at the beginning of World War II. He stayed with
his family at the Fresno assembly center for three months. His parents
were moved to Jerome, Arkansas, where they spent a year and a half, while
Henmi was relased from the assembly center to attend college. Henmi's
mother's family later died in the bombing of Hiroshima.
